So, 'Return to Real Kashmir FC' is this fascinating piece that dives into the life of Davie Robertson, who’s quite the character. The film does a solid job of showcasing the resilience and spirit of a football team operating in Kashmir, amidst all the chaos. It's not just about the sport; it’s about hope, survival, and community, set against this backdrop of conflict. The pacing feels contemplative, allowing you to really soak in the atmosphere of the region. The personal stories and the sheer determination of the players stand out, making it distinct. You get a real sense of place and struggle, and there’s something quite raw and genuine in the way it’s filmed, almost documentary-like in feel. Definitely worth a watch if you appreciate films that merge sports with real-world issues.
